Not a good idea turning cold start off if you still have your primary cats. It's designed to protect them from damage at startup.
Not worth risking the cost of new cats for the sake of 30 seconds louder noise imo.

I believe he can taylor the sound how you want but to be honest I'd recommend you get the full treatment and then tone it down if you want using the bootmod3 flash which allows you to control all the baffles, when it kicks in, what revs, how aggressive etc. It's awesome! Still super quiet in comfort too
